About Derrick Alston:
Derrick Alston (full name: Derrick Samuel Alston; no nicknames) played Forward from 1995 until 1997 for the Philadelphia 76ers and Atlanta Hawks. Over 3 seasons, he played 139 games, scored 751 points (5.4 ppg) and grabbed 525 rebounds (3.8 rpg). Alston also dished out 94 assists (0.7 apg), made 95 steals (0.7 spg), and blocked 87 shots (0.6 bpg) during his career. Born in Bronx, New York on August 20, 1972, Alston stands 6-11 and weighs 225 lbs. He attended high school at Hoboken in Hoboken, New Jersey and college at Duquesne University. He was drafted by the Philadelphia 76ers in the 2nd round (6th pick, 33rd overall) of the 1994 NBA draft.
